Opened 4 years ago
#6105 assigned defect
AlphaFold fails in hhblits making sequence alignment
Reported by: | Tom Goddard | Owned by: | Tom Goddard |
---|---|---|---|
Priority: | moderate | Milestone: | |
Component: | Structure Prediction | Version: | |
Keywords: | Cc: | mtrnka@… | |
Blocked By: | Blocking: | ||
Notify when closed: | Platform: | all | |
Project: | ChimeraX |
Description
AlphaFold 2.1.1 fails with an error in hhblits, for example, with the sequence from PDB 7M1P
Error in /tmp/hh-suite/src/hhalignment.cpp:3539: MergeMasterSlave: did not find 569 match states in sequence 1 of tr|A0A1H9CGJ3|A0A1H9CGJ3_9FIRM. Sequence: MVKVNGIRKTFGANEVLKGVSFEIEEGTIYGLIGRNGAGKTTLMNIMSGLLKADSGTFDMGTGKGSGKTQVGYLPDLPNFYDYLTTDEYLDFLLMESNPVRRDALLETVGLGKGLRIKTMSRGMKQRLGIAAVLVNDPKIILLDEPTSALDPAGRADVRSILMKLKSEGKTIILSTHILADMDSICDKAGFLAKGVIAREVNIAESRESASIMTISFASEPDLPTLHKYAPEIYIMDKCTIKIVLDKSDIITSQQKALQGLSQLPQEITSISSAALSLDNIFQEVCL
I attach the full alphafold log run on wynton. This error supposedly occurs only with full alphafold, not Google Colab which does not use hhblits. It has been reported to the Alphafold and hh-suite projects:
https://github.com/deepmind/alphafold/issues/177
https://github.com/soedinglab/hh-suite/issues/277
A suggested work-around is to update the UniClust database, although this probably just changes which sequences it fails on.
Attachments (1)
Note:
See TracTickets
for help on using tickets.
AlphaFold log with sequence alignment failure